From manual to digital autonomy
Before 2021, ArvatoConnect faced a common industry challenge: separate systems and manual processes; which coupled with employees working varied shifts across multiple client accounts, made workforce management quite complex. "Our previous system had limitations”, Rab explains. "We had a lot of manual processes with various sources rather than one system to track everything. The key driver for us was to record people clocking in and out accurately, so we can join this up with payroll”.
By implementing the OneAdvanced suite, they moved to a centralised platform. This wasn't just a technical upgrade; it was a cultural shift towards transparency. Managers can now approve overtime and track holiday balances in real-time, while the data flows automatically from the clock-in gate to the payslip.
Empowering the desk-free workforce
For Jessica, who "lives and breathes" the systems for eight hours a day, the biggest win has been employee self-service. In a contact centre environment, giving agents visibility over their own data is a powerful engagement tool.
"We’ve moved to a space where we’ve given employees much more visibility and accessibility”, says Jessica. "If I can see my own data and make sure it looks right, it leads to less complications and confusion further down the line”.
Rab echoes this sentiment, noting that the self-support features allow employees to see exactly how many hours they’ve worked, what has been deducted for absence, and what their take-home pay will look like. This clarity has directly impacted the workplace atmosphere. When asked about the change in employee sentiment since 2021, Jessica notes simply: “There’s a real shift - people feel more confident, and we’re hearing few concerns”.
The power of true agility
One of the standout themes of the ArvatoConnect success story is the ability to treat the software as a platform rather than a static product. Unlike many rigid HR solutions, OneAdvanced allows the team to utilise the applications that are most important right now, giving them the agility required to meet rapidly changing employment laws and client needs.
"The ability to adopt the functionality we need in an agile manner has been massive”, Jessica highlights. "We just implemented flexible working tracking as part of our software suite. The seamless interface and standardised UX across the board make it very easy to navigate even for non-technical users. Many platforms do not tick these boxes".
The cloud-based nature of the systems and automatic updates mean they don’t have to wait for certain cycles to end before they can innovate either. Whether it’s improving workflows across different client accounts or adapting to new regulations, the flexibility is there for the tech stack to evolve.
Tangible impact: Accuracy and integration
While the human element of the software is vital, the business metrics tell an equally compelling story:
- Payroll accuracy: Rab notes that by integrating T&A, HR, and Payroll into a single ecosystem, the business has seen a significant improvement in precision.
- Operational efficiency: The platform now acts as the central system across the ArvatoConnect ecosystem, with data feeding in and out of various other business tools, reducing duplication of effort.
- Scalability: Over the last 12 months, they have successfully rolled out the T&A solution to additional client accounts, moving from zero usage to full adoption seamlessly.
